LevelDb 是 Google 開源的持久化 KV 單機存儲引擎。 針對存儲面對的普遍隨機 IO 問題,leveldb 采用了 merge-dump 的方式,將邏輯場景的寫請求轉換成順序寫log 和寫 memtable 操作,由后台進程將 memtable 持久化成 sstable。 對於讀 ...
了解leveldb 的snapshot首先得了解SequenceNumber。當插入數據時,SequenceNumber會依次增長,例如插入key , key , key , key 等數據時,依次對應的SequenceNumber為 , , , 。當然,並不是每次都會如此簡單,當存在合並寫時,例如key , key , key , key ,key . key 對應的SequenceNumbe ...
2014-04-04 00:02 0 2702 推薦指數:
LevelDb 是 Google 開源的持久化 KV 單機存儲引擎。 針對存儲面對的普遍隨機 IO 問題,leveldb 采用了 merge-dump 的方式,將邏輯場景的寫請求轉換成順序寫log 和寫 memtable 操作,由后台進程將 memtable 持久化成 sstable。 對於讀 ...
一、LevelDB入門 LevelDB是Google開源的持久化KV單機數據庫,具有很高的隨機寫,順序讀/寫性能,但是隨機讀的性能很一般,也就是說,LevelDB很適合應用在查詢較少,而寫很多的場景。LevelDB應用了LSM (Log Structured Merge) 策略 ...
回顧一下上一講的內容。 分布式——吞吐量巨強、Hbase的承載者 LSMT leveldb簡介 ...
初識:LevelDB 上篇文章緣起:BigTable可以說是已經把論文Bigtable: A Distributed Storage System for Structured Data中的內容掰扯的明明白白,如果哪位小伙伴感覺還有不理解的點,可以點連接進去再反復琢磨幾遍,說不定就頓悟 ...
1、GA/PRE/SNAPSHOT詳解 1)GA: General Availability,正式發布的版本,官方推薦使用該版本,國外很多項目都是使用GA來表示正式發布版本的 2) PRE: 預覽版,主要是用來內部開發人員和測試人員測試使用,因此不建議使用 ...
LevelDB學習筆記 (1):初識LevelDB 1. 寫在前面 1.1 什么是levelDB LevelDB就是一個由Google開源的高效的單機Key/Value存儲系統,該存儲系統提供了Key到Value的有序映射。 地址: https://github.com ...
下載並安裝 LevelDB 下載並安裝PHP LevelDB 添加leveldb.so到/etc/php.ini文件中 重啟Apache,效果見圖1 圖1 ...
一、Repositories 在elasticsearch.yml文件中增加path.repo路徑配置: $ vim /etc/elasticsearch/elasticsearch.yml p ...